The Village Head of Kurmin Wali community in Kajuru Local Government Area of Kaduna State, Mr. Ishaku Dan’azumi, has reported that bandits who abducted 177 Christian worshippers were sighted on Thursday morning moving with their captives around the Maro axis of the council area.

In a telephone interview, Dan’azumi said the abductors and their victims were seen trekking on foot between Ungwan Gamu and Maro communities, though their exact destination remains unknown.

The traditional ruler added that the development followed threats issued by the bandits on Wednesday evening, after they became aware of the presence of security operatives in the area.

“They called us yesterday evening and threatened the community, accusing us of bringing soldiers. They said we were claiming to have ‘big people’ backing us because of the military presence,” Dan’azumi said.

Authorities are yet to confirm the exact location of the hostages as security operations continue in the area.
